Multi-Truck Crash Closed I-95 South in Greenwich

Three tractor-trailers and two cars collided in Greenwich.

Southbound lanes of Interstate 95 in the Greenwich-Stamford area are reopening after an accident involving three tractor trailers and two motor vehicles.

The crash happened between exits 5 and 6 at 2:35 a.m. Friday morning and the southbound lanes were closed, according to the state Department of Transportation.

Police said a car spun out of control and a tractor-trailer tried unsuccessfully to swerve to avoid a collision. The other tractor-trailers and another remaining motor vehicle also tried to avoid a crash, but collided and piled up.

State police reported a small fuel leak from one of the tractor trailers.

Police believe there were no major injuries.
